The tummy tuck procedure is a cosmetic surgery that removes excess skin and fat while tightening loose abdominal (rectus diastasis) muscles.
It is ideal for individuals with sagging skin, weakened stomach muscles, or stubborn fat in the abdomen that does not respond to traditional weight loss methods.
Dr. Lovell incorporates liposuction into the tummy tuck procedure for additional fat removal and body contouring, and all of her tummy tucks are drainless. Many patients also choose to combine their tummy tuck with fat grafting to the buttocks [Brazilian Butt Lift (BBL)] for a balanced, curvier silhouette.
Types of tummy tuck surgery include:
Mini Tummy Tuck: Focuses on the lower abdomen, ideal for patients with mild skin laxity and muscle separation below the belly button.
Full (Complete) Abdominoplasty: Removes excess fat and skin on the abdomen, tightens the entire abdominal wall, and repositions the belly button.
Extended Tummy Tuck: Addresses the lower abdomen and flanks, removing more skin on the sides than a traditional tummy tuck.
Circumferential Abdominoplasty: Also known as a lower body lift, this technique is often helpful for massive weight loss patients, reshaping the stomach, flanks, outer thighs, and lower back for a comprehensive contouring effect.

Recovery from tummy tuck surgery varies depending on the extent of the procedure. Most patients return to light activities in 2-3 weeks, but strenuous exercise must be avoided for 6-8 weeks. Compression garments are worn to support healing and reduce swelling. Dr. Lovell always uses Exparel local anesthetic during the surgery and will also prescribe pain medicine and a muscle relaxant to help patients manage discomfort during early recovery. As post-surgical swelling gradually subsides over 3-6 months, your final, refined results are revealed.
Initial improvements are visible immediately, but swelling takes 3-6 months to fully subside at which point you will see your final results. In the areas where you had liposuction final results are often evident at 9-12 months once the swelling has completely subsided.
Results are long-lasting when maintained with a healthy lifestyle and stable weight. Future pregnancies or significant weight gain may alter results, so it is important to do your tummy tuck at the right time in your life to ensure lasting benefits. Dr. Lovell also advises her patients to have a BMI below 30 and be within 15 pounds of their goal weight when they get their tummy tuck to minimize the risk of complications and improve cosmetic outcomes.

A tummy tuck is not a weight-loss procedure but rather a body contouring surgery designed to remove excess skin and fat and tighten abdominal muscles. Most patients lose a few pounds from the removed tissue, but the main goal is to create a flatter, firmer abdomen rather than reduce overall body weight.
A full (complete) tummy tuck removes excess skin and fat from the entire abdominal area, tightens separated abdominal muscles, and repositions the belly button for a smooth, natural appearance. A mini abdominoplasty is a less invasive cosmetic surgery that only addresses the lower abdomen and is ideal for patients with minimal sagging below the belly button.
Recovery involves moderate discomfort, especially in the first week after surgery. Patients may experience tightness, swelling, and soreness, which can be managed with prescribed pain medicine and proper post-surgical care. Most patients return to light activities within 2-3 weeks and feel fully recovered within 6-8 weeks.

Tummy tuck results are long-lasting, especially when maintained with a healthy lifestyle and stable weight. While natural aging and future pregnancies may affect results over time, most patients enjoy a smoother, firmer abdomen for years after surgery.
Yes, a tummy tuck can help reduce stretch marks, but only in certain areas. Since the procedure removes excess skin from the lower portion of the abdomen, any stretch marks located below the naval are often removed along with it. Stretch marks above the belly button may become less noticeable as the remaining skin is pulled tighter. While a tummy tuck isn’t specifically designed to treat stretch marks, many patients see a significant improvement in skin smoothness and tone as part of their overall transformation.
